University of Nairobi to mentor Koitaleel Samoei University College

The University of Nairobi will mentor Koitaleel Samoei University College as its constituent college.

The new constituent collegewill be located in Nandi County. The University of Nairobi is expected to offer advice as regards, academic and administrative staff exchanges, academic programs and technical expertise to steer the University College to acquire the status of a fully fledged University and to a world class status, this was revealed by the Vice-Chancellor, Prof. Peter M. F. Mbithi in his office during the signing of the Memorandum of Understanding between the University of Nairobi and KoitaleelSamoeiManagement in the presence of Nandi Governor Dr.CleophasLagattoday April, 7, 2015.

Among the courses that will be offered include Bachelor of Commerce, Bachelor of Arts and Bachelor of Laws (LLB). The University College will be headed by Principal assisted by two Deputy Principals.

According to the Universities Act, a mentoring institution must agree to mentor a new institution as a requirement for approval of the new institution by Commission For Universities Education, (CUE). The University of Nairobi will mentor the new constituent university to a fully fledged University when they will eventually get a charter. The Commission for University Education carried out a technical inspection of the proposed Koitaleel Samoei University College with a purpose to assess the adequacy and appropriateness of the academic resources. The inspection by CUE also involved the inspection on the physical facilities, human resources, financial resources, library resources, academic programs and student enrolment, the University College Master Plan, and the Strategic Plan.

The establishment of Koitalel Samoei University College is in line with the requirement that there shall be a public university in every county. Secondly, the University will be a stimulus for the achievement of Vision 2030 goals as well as preserve the cultural history of the Nandi people in memory of the legendary leader KoitaleelarapSamoei.

At the moment, the University of Nairobi is mentoringEmbu University College, which has recorded significant improvement since its establishment in 2011. Recently, EUC was awardedISO 9000: 2008 Certification in December 2014 and it launched its Strategic Plan for the Period 2014-2019.
